Safeguarding Your Investment: The Importance Of Art Gallery Insurance

Art galleries are more than just a space to showcase beautiful pieces of art; they are also a business that requires protection. With valuable pieces of art on display, art gallery owners face numerous risks that can result in significant financial losses if not adequately insured. art gallery insurance is a crucial investment to safeguard not only the artwork but also the livelihood of the gallery owners.

art gallery insurance provides coverage for various risks that galleries face, including theft, vandalism, fire, water damage, and natural disasters. These policies are designed specifically for art galleries and can protect the valuable assets within the gallery space. Without adequate insurance, a single catastrophic event could lead to the closure of a gallery and the loss of precious artwork.

One of the primary risks that art galleries face is the threat of theft. High-value artwork can be a tempting target for thieves, and if stolen, the financial repercussions can be devastating. art gallery insurance can provide coverage for theft, ensuring that the gallery owners are compensated for the value of the stolen artwork. This coverage can help mitigate the financial impact of a theft and enable the gallery to recover and continue operating.

Vandalism is another risk that art galleries must consider. Unfortunately, art galleries can be targeted by vandals looking to damage or destroy valuable pieces of art. Art gallery insurance can provide coverage for vandalism, offering financial protection in the event that artwork is defaced or destroyed. With this coverage in place, gallery owners can have peace of mind knowing that they are protected against such risks.

In addition to theft and vandalism, art galleries are also at risk of damage from fire, water, and natural disasters. A fire or flood in a gallery space can result in the destruction of priceless artwork, leading to substantial financial losses. Art gallery insurance can provide coverage for these types of incidents, ensuring that the artwork is protected and the gallery owners are compensated for their losses. With this coverage in place, galleries can recover from such events and continue operating without facing significant financial hardship.

Beyond protecting the artwork itself, art gallery insurance can also provide coverage for liability risks. Galleries that host events or exhibitions may face liability claims if a guest is injured on the premises. Art gallery insurance can provide liability coverage, protecting gallery owners from financial responsibility in the event of a lawsuit. This coverage is essential for galleries that welcome visitors and host events, as it helps protect the gallery owners from potential legal costs and damages.
